Summary
In this recording, Kwame Ture critiques the notion of individual advancement within the capitalist system, arguing that true progress for African people only occurs through the advancement of the masses. He highlights how mass struggles have historically resulted in token individual successes that are falsely celebrated as racial progress, while the material conditions of the majority worsen. This contradiction, combined with rising political consciousness, points toward revolutionary change.

The Africans in America who do not think properly on their own culture, but think like the enemy, make great confusion. If you look at the struggle of Africans all over the world and in America, you will see that they struggle as a mass people. All their struggles are mass struggles. Yet, all their advancements are individual advancements. Hear us properly. We say the masses struggle, and then the capitalist system gives us an individual who advances, maybe the first one to work for IBM, the first one to work for Coca-Cola, who knows. And this first one is so confused that they actually think that by being the first one to work for IBM that they have been a credit to the race. Indeed, they believe they have advanced the race. There is nothing but clear stupidity, backward thinking, confusion by the capitalist system. If the masses of our people suffer for our advancement, progress only comes when the masses advance. If the masses do not progress, there's no progress at all. If one knows this, there's no discussion about since the 60s. Certainly since the 60s, many individuals have climbed up. Some have become mayors, some basketball players, some football players, some on television, some movie directors. All of this is a result of the struggles of the mass of the people. But the conditions of the mass of our people become worse. For someone to discuss progress means that they're clearly confused. There's been no progress for our people. The conditions are worse. The only progress for our people is the rising consciousness of the masses, which will never stop. Aside from the rising consciousness of our people, the conditions are worse for the masses of our people. If you have rising consciousness and worse conditions, there's no question you're heading for the path of revolutions.
